Brazil’s legendary footballer gets the documentary he deserves in David Tryhorn and Ben Nicholas’ (Crossing The Line) deep career dive. Boasting evocative archive footage, insightful interviews and a head-tohead with the main man, this is not just a portrait of the three-time World Cup winner but a fascinating depiction of Brazil in the ’60s, when the country was plunged into dictatorship. Far removed from your typical football doc – no Gary Lineker popping up here – it’ll add fuel to those ‘Who’s the greatest?’ (virtual) pub debates.
